Fellowes Mars A4 Information
The Fellowes Mars A4 is a home and personal laminator that is designed for occasional use. It is compact and lightweight, making it easy to store and transport. The laminator has a clear low-friction path for documents, which ensures that it is 100% jam-free when used with Fellowes branded laminating pouches. It has an automatic temperature setting that makes it easy to use, and it has visual indicators that clearly signal when the laminator is ready to use. The Mars A4 can laminate documents up to A4 size and has a lamination speed of 30cm per minute. It is also backed by a one-year warranty.
